THE CALIFORNIA YMCA YOUTH & GOVERNMENT PROGRAM
Since its inception 61 years ago, the California YMCA Youth & Government program has helped prepare high-school students for success in life.
The program offers two excellent educational models: Legislature/Court and United Nations.
Model Legislature/Court. This statewide program gives 2200 high-school students from 90 different California YMCAs a six-month “hands-on” experience based on our state government. The teen delegates write bills, prepare briefs, run for elected offices, and attend statewide training events culminating in a five-day Model Legislature & Court Program held in Sacramento.
Model United Nations. This model engages 350 middle-school students in an interactive simulation of the United Nations. Each student serves as an ambassador representing a country from around the world. Through research and writing on critical issues impacting our world today, and through interaction with other ambassadors, participants learn to appreciate diverse cultures and develop a better understanding of our global community.
